Output 58e34a066e3f9e8103b4357d184d20b23e6851c45aa7f81a80a22606091cfd30:0

value
1386470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b261e2bdf91a376ea1864760e9cad9cf02490b OP_EQUAL
address
3PYR7ce8i4VurTG7catMJv4sMdMgirPAqt
transaction
58e34a066e3f9e8103b4357d184d20b23e6851c45aa7f81a80a22606091cfd30
spent
true